sleeping is a mission the pain in my legs and hips is just not nice. what will help ease it? seems like I carry the pain all day now. 33+3 weeks does this mean I could be going into early labor and my body just preparing itself??

Do you have a pregnancy pillow? If not a regular works too..
I had it with my second pregnancy and I put a pillow between my legs (I could only sleep on my side at that term) it helped to relax my legs and hip.
Also what really helped was wearing a belly belt. The belt was partially holding the belly weight and would give my hips and legs some time out..

Get yourself to a Physio as soon as possible. I went private because the wait for NHS was so long. A few simple but very focuses exercises really helped when I was suffering from the same thing. Didn't cure but stabilised so I didn't get any worse as the pregnancy progressed, I've known people to end up on crutches
